WINFIELD SCOTT WOOTEN

Officer Rank: Special Agent
Memorial Panel: 62-W: 27
Department: Missouri, Kansas, Texas Railroad, P.D.
End of Watch: March 16, 1941
Cause: SHOT
Age: 28
Years of Service: 8
Description: Special Agent Wooten was shot and killed as he attempted to arrest a speeding motorist who was travelling at over 90 mph in a residential area in Tulsa, OK. The car crashed into a telephone pole, and Agent Wooten placed the motorist under arrest. The man attacked Agent Wooten, took his weapon and shot him eight times with his own gun. When Officer L.R. Rogers arrived at the scene and exited his patrol car, he was also shot and killed (39-W: 8). Responding officers returned fire and killed the suspect.
